/* ARCHIEF.CSS (c) Hans Geraedts */
/* general */
body {font: 70%/1.5 verdana, helvetica, serif; margin-left: 0em; margin-top: 0em; margin-right: 10px; border: 0px none;color: #000000;background: #FAFAFA;}
.noscrollbody {border: 0px none;margin: 0px;padding: 0px; background: #FAFAFA url(images/bg_striped.gif) repeat;}
.bodyInIFrame {margin: 0px; border: 0px none;padding: 0px;}
table {font: 100%/1.2 verdana, helvetica, serif; border: 0px none;}
FORM, OPTION, TEXTAREA, INPUT, SELECT, TH, TD {font-size:100%;}
iframe {border: 0px none;padding: 0px; margin: 0px;}
p {text-align: justify;}
a {text-decoration: none;color: #1D508C;}
a:hover {text-decoration: underline;}
acronym {text-decoration: none;}
strong {font-weight: 600;}
form {margin: 0em;}
img {border: 0px none}
.note {color: Red; font-weight:bold;}
.hand {cursor: pointer;}
.hidden {display: none;}

/* layout */
#divBackground {position: absolute;z-index: 0;width: 100%;height: 100%;left: 0px;top: 0px; border: 0px none; padding: 0px; margin: 0px;}
#divMenu {width: 680px; border: 0px none; padding: 0px; margin: 0px;}
#divContentBack {position: absolute;z-index: 1;width: 680px;height: 520px;top: 75px;left: 170px;background: #FAFAFA;
	margin: 0em;padding: 5px 10px 10px 10px;}
#divWhere {font: 80%/1.5 verdana, helvetica, serif;color: #000000;font-weight: bold;text-align: right;padding: 0.2em 0em 0.4em 0.2em;}
#divContent {height: 100%;width: 100%;}
#frmContent {height: 100%;width: 100%;border: 0px none;padding: 0px; margin: 0px;}
#divAanmelden {clear: both;float: none;width: 100%;}
#frmAanmelden {width: 100%;border: 0px none;padding: 0px; margin: 0px;}
#frmTHAReactie {width: 100%;border: 0px none;padding: 0px; margin: 0px;}

/* TimeLine documents */
hr {color: #1D508C;height: 1px;}
.imgTopRight {width: 270px; font: 80%/1.5 verdana, helvetica, serif;float: right;padding: 0.5em 0em 1em 1em;text-align: right;}
.imgTopRight img {border: 0px solid #1D508C;}
.imgRight {font-size: smaller;clear: both;padding: 1em 0em 1em 1em;text-align: right;}

/* other text */
/* welkom */
.divFotoMaand {
	border:#cccccc 1px solid;
	background:url(images/bg_paper.jpg) #ffffff;
	margin-bottom:5px;
	cursor:pointer;
}
.imgFotoMaand { width: 335px;}
.divBijschrift {
	padding: 3px;
	font-style: italic;
	text-align: justify;
}
#divWelkom {width: 335px;}
.newsItems {float: right; text-align: justify; width: 280px; margin-left: 10px;}
.newsItemImportant {padding-left: 3px;padding-right: 3px; background: #6F87A7; color:#FFFFFF;}
.newsItem {cursor:pointer;}

.newsItemImg {float: right;padding: 0.3em 0em 0.5em 0.5em;}
/* .newsItemImg {float: left;padding: 0.3em 0.5em 0.5em 0em;} */
.newsItemImg img {border: 0px solid #1D508C;}
.newsItemLink {text-align: right;color: #1D508C;}
.newsItemHeader {color: #1D508C; font-weight:bold;}

/* tabels */
.priceTable {width: 80%;}
.dotTD {width: 1em;vertical-align: top;}
.euroTD {width: 2em;text-align: right;vertical-align: top;}
.priceTD {width: 3em;text-align: right;vertical-align: top;}

.tableLabel {width: 17em;vertical-align: top;}

.linkTable {width: 100%;}
.linkTable td {padding-bottom: 1.2em;}
.linkLabel {width: 14em;}
.linkTable td {vertical-align: top;text-align: justify;}

/* general */
.titleHeader {font-weight: bold;margin-bottom: 0.5em;text-transform: uppercase;color: #1d508c;
	line-height: normal;font-style: normal;letter-spacing: 0.4em;font-variant: normal;
}
.normalHeader {font: 100% verdana, helvetica, serif;font-weight: bold;color: #1D508C;letter-spacing: .1em;margin-bottom: 0.3em;}
.headerColor {color: #1D508C;}
.date {font: 80% verdana, helvetica, serif;}
.paraGraph {text-align: justify;margin-bottom: 1em;}
.indentP {margin-left: 3em;margin-bottom: 1em;text-align: justify;}
.goTop {float: right;text-align: right;}
.bijschrift { font-weight: bold; font-size: 80%;}

/* forms */
select
{
	border: #cccccc 1px solid;
	background: #fafafa;
	width: 14em;
}
.aspSearchForm
{
	border: #cccccc 1px solid;
	background: url(images/bg_paper.jpg) #ffffff;
	width: 100%;
}
.aspSearchForm table {margin: 5px 10px 5px 10px;font: 100%/1.5 verdana, helvetica, serif;}
.aspSearchForm tr {height: 2.5em;}
.aspFormTextBox {width: 14em;background: #FAFAFA;border: #CCCCCC 1px solid;}
.aspFormCheckBox {margin-left: -4px;}
.aspFormNrBox {width: 2em;background: #FAFAFA;border: #CCCCCC 1px solid;}
.aspFormListTextBox
{
	border: #CCCCCC 1px solid;
	background: #fafafa;
	width: 9em;
}
.aspFormMemo
{
	border: #CCCCCC 1px solid;
	background: #fafafa;
	font: 95%/1.2 verdana, helvetica, serif;
	overflow: auto;
	width: 400px;
}
.aspFormTBnoWidth {background: #FAFAFA;border: #CCCCCC 1px solid;}
.aspFormLabel {width: 10em;}
.aspFormButton {color: #FAFAFA;border: none;width: 8em;background-color: #6F87A7;cursor: pointer;}
.aspFormListButton {color: #FAFAFA;border: none;width: 4em;background-color: #6F87A7;cursor: pointer;}
.aspFormReset {color: #FAFAFA;border: none;width: 10em;background-color: #6F87A7;cursor: pointer;}

/* result pages */
.resultTable {width: 100%;}
.resultHeader {border-top: #1d508c 1px solid;color: #1d508c;border-bottom: #1d508c 1px solid;background-color: wheat;}
.resultTable td {vertical-align: top;}
.otherTD {padding-bottom: 1em;border-bottom: #1d508c 1px solid;text-align: justify;}
.buttonTD {width: 10em;}
.imageTD {width: 100px;padding-bottom: 1em;border-bottom: #1d508c 0px solid;}
.idTD {width: 10em;}
.resultTable b {color: #555555;}
.markSearch {background-color: wheat;}

/* result burgemeester, dossiers */
.jaarTD {width: 8em;}
.invTD {text-align: right; width: 6em;padding-right: 1em;}
.titelTD {padding-bottom: 1em;border-top: #1d508c 1px solid;text-align: justify;}
.tekstTD {text-align: justify;}
.emptyTD {border-bottom: #1d508c 1px solid;text-align: justify;}
.formLabelTD {width: 11em; color: #555555;font-weight:bold;}
.blzTD {width: 11em;padding-right: 1em;}

/* pagers */
.pager b {color: #1d508c;}

/* gallery */
.hand { cursor: pointer;}
#divGallery { position: absolute; z-index: 1000; left: 0; top: 0; width: 100%; height: 100%; background-color: #1D508C;}
#divGalleryTop { width: 100%; height: 3%; background-color: #1D508C; cursor: pointer; text-align: center;}
#divGalleryTopContent { padding-top: 3px; font-weight: bold; color: White;}
#frmGallery { border: 0px none; padding: 0px; margin: 0px; width: 100%; height: 97%;}

.erfgoedhuisFooter { margin-top: 1em;}
.erfgoedhuisFooter table { width: 100%; padding: 0; margin: 0;}
.erfgoedhuisFooter table td { text-align: center; padding: 0; margin: 0; padding-top: 3px;}